Reminding, Watching, Remembering

Old Testament:  When God remembers (zakar) someone in need, He doesn’t just recall to mind as we do, but with Him it is an intense focus that is rooted in activity as He works on behalf of our prayers.  Zakar is the outworking of God’s love toward us.  With zakar, it also engages the work of our hands, the words of our mouths to take action upon that thought.  Zakar means to mark and therefore is an intense focus upon a thought that results in action.

New Testament:  Unlike zakar in the OT, much of what the NT focuses on is stirring ourselves up.  We are to warn one another in love and remember God’s promises.  Through prayer we go back to what has been marked so that God may join with us in taking action upon what we have prayed in the name of Jesus.  We are also to stay awake, stay vigilant and to keep watch.  We are to be perceptive and discerning in all things.  We are to behold the glory of our Lord; to linger in His presence and rejoice at His leading and revelation in our lives.  This keeps us fresh and alive and continually leads us in a lifestyle of prayer and, with humility and gratitude, holding the gift of “zakar” before the Lord, with invitation, so that He may join with us in doing the work and rejoice in what comes to pass.
